Look, we all know what the Start and Select buttons are, but they've also not officially been called that on official controllers for some years now.

On Xbox, it's View and Menu. On PlayStation, it's Options and...I guess 'Select' has been functionally replaced with a touchpad click. On Nintendo, it's + and -.

But what do you call those buttons? Do you still call them by the old names of Start and Select? Do you go by what the current official name for the buttons on whatever controller you currently use is? Or do you not care at all and just think of them as 'Yeah those ones' because (minus Nintendo) modern official controllers don't label these buttons with their names at all?

Personally I still call 'em Start and Select, it's just what I'm used to.

Even when the SNES came out the Select button became vestigial as it was no longer used to select the game mode yet I will always defend those names because Option/Share and View/Menu are functionally the same thing as Start and Select regardless of the new names given to them.

I can understand Plus and Minus on the Wiimote since that controller was supposed to be like a remote (thus the on/off button on the corner) yet this also became vestigial by the time the Wii U came out.

Edit: I still like Start and Run from the PC Engine pad because it was a fitting name.
